WHAT: The New Orleans Film Society and The Chalmette Theatre present two

screenings of “Trust,” directed by David Schwimmer. Safe and sound in their

suburban home, Will and Lynn Cameron (Clive Owen and Catherine Keener)

used to sleep well at night, trusting their children were protected. Will, in

particular, was comforted by the fact that he and Lynn raised three bright

children, and that once the doors were locked and the alarm was set, nothingabsolutely

nothing-was going to harm his family. When his 14-year-old

daughter, Annie (Liana Liberato) made a new friend online-a 16-year-old boy

named Charlie whom she met in a volleyball chat room-Annie becomes

enraptured by him after weeks of communicating with him. Slowly, Annie

learns he is not who he claims to be, yet she remains intrigued by Charlie even

as the truth about him is uncovered. The devastating revelation reverberates

through her entire family, setting in motion a chain of events that forever

change their lives in ways that no one could have predicted. Directed by

David Schwimmer (“Friends”).

Since 1989, the New Orleans Film Society (NOFS) (http://neworleansfilmsociety.org) has engaged, educated, and inspired through the art of film. This year, 2011, marks the 22nd anniversary of the New

Orleans Film Festival. NOFS hosts special events throughout the year: the French Film Festival, the New

Orleans International Children’s Film Festival, and other events designed to benefit local film audiences, artists, and professionals. NOFS partners with local organizations to present monthly film series. NOFS

reaches 8,000 people through its programming. NOFS is a 501( c )(3) organization.
